Abstract
The evaluation of cold tolerance at the germination period,the budbersting period,the seedling stage and the booting stage and its correlation analysis were conducted,using 204 accessions of core collection of rice(Oryza sativa L.)in China.The results showed that there were obvious different cold tolerance between Japonica rice and Indica rice of sub species,and among rice germplasms.The cold tolerance of Japonica rices was stronger than those of Indica rices,but there were some stronger cold tolerant germplasms of Indica rices.The Japonica rices such as Gaoyangdiandaodahongmang,Feidongtangdao,Muxiqiu,Weiguo,Xingguo,Shanjiugu,Zhonghua 8 ect.and Indica rices such as Baoxuan 21,Hongmisandanbai,Cungunuo,Honggu ect.were showed stronger cold tolerance in several growing stages,which should be used in rice breeding for cold tolerance and identification of gene associating with cold tolerance.The seed setting rate under natural low temperature and cold water irrigation were significantly positively correlated with the vigor of germination under low temperature,while which were significantly negatively correlated with dead seedling rate,that was the rice germplasms with stronger cold tolerance at the germination period and the bud busting period under low temperature,had stronger cold tolerance at the booting stage.So the vigor of germination and dead seedling rate under low temperature could be used as cold tolerant index of cold tolerance at the booting stage in early growing stage.
